These server resources include CPU, bandwidth, disk space, RAM, etc. Reseller hosting: Reseller hosting is a type of hosting service where one can resell or rent out server space and its resources to other customers, in turn, earning a profit. Moreover, each virtual server has its own operating system, which works independently. In a virtual private server, you get server resources completely dedicated to you, so there is no sharing of any server resources like RAM, CPU, storage, etc. In simple words: 1 powerful physical server hosts multiple virtual servers, each isolated from the others. VPS hosting: VPS makes use of virtualization technology in which one dedicated server is split into several virtual private servers. Whereas, Windows shared hosting is suitable for websites built in ASP. Linux shared hosting is ideal for websites with PHP and MySQL. MilesWeb stands out from other providers as we provide hosting for both Linux & Windows platforms. This is the best web hosting solution for beginners, small and medium websites/blogs. Shared hosting: This is the cheapest web hosting as multiple websites are hosted on the same server, where each user is allocated a specific amount of space and resources that can be utilized for hosting their website.
